Naylor Communications Cafeteria, 2001. "This is a ninety feet long wall that wraps around the entire cafeteria. This is one corner of that Mural. Part of the wall (not visible here) was another business analogy of fishing and casting nets from the boat further to reach/catch more customers. At the left, the Mural is bleeding off into another part of the room. There is a kitchenette there, and I wanted a way of making a transition zone from the Mural itself into the stark white cabinets of the kitchenette. So the Mural fades itself out at this part."
